Is Queen Creek, AZ or Rancho Cordova, CA safer?

Queen Creek is safer with a higher safety score by 17 points. Queen Creek, AZ has a safety score of 82/100 while Rancho Cordova, CA has 65/100, based on FBI Uniform Crime Report data.

What is the violent crime rate in Queen Creek, AZ vs Rancho Cordova, CA?

Queen Creek, AZ has a violent crime rate of 119.8 per 100,000 residents, while Rancho Cordova, CA has 425.7 per 100,000. Lower rates indicate safer communities. The national average is approximately 380 per 100,000.

What is the property crime rate in Queen Creek, AZ vs Rancho Cordova, CA?

Queen Creek, AZ has a property crime rate of 821.6 per 100,000, compared to 2111.9 per 100,000 in Rancho Cordova, CA. Property crimes include burglary, theft, and motor vehicle theft.
